An immigration judge presides over hearings in federal immigration court. They are responsible for deciding whether an individual can remain in the U.S. or must be removed. If you have been issued a Notice to Appear, you will face a judge who evaluates your legal arguments and evidence. The 1924 Immigration Act, also known as the Johnson-Reed Act, established strict quotas based on national origin, severely restricting immigration from Southern and Eastern Europe and banning immigration from Asia.
